  2. 12 de mai. de 2024 · I.M. Pei, Chinese-born American architect known for his large, elegantly designed urban buildings and complexes. Notable projects included the controversial glass pyramid (1989) at the Louvre in Paris and the offshore Museum of Islamic Art (2008) in Doha, Qatar. Pei was awarded the Pritzker Prize in 1983.

  3. 1. Pei’s childhood shaped his creative approach. Ieoh Ming Pei was born in Guangzhou, China, on April 26, 1917. His family moved to Hong Kong when he was one and then to the quickly modernizing Shanghai when he was 10. Pei spent several summers in Suzhou, the home of his ancestors.
